yellow jacket

American  

noun

  1. any of several paper wasps of the family Vespidae, having black and bright yellow bands.

  2. Slang. a yellow capsule of phenobarbital.


yellow jacket British  

noun

  1. any of several social wasps of the genus Vespa, having yellow markings on the body
